Для чего нужен калькулятор битрейта видео
Этот калькулятор битрейта видео оценивает битрейт и итоговый размер файла на основе разрешения, частоты кадров, длительности ролика и выбранной вами степени сжатия. Это удобный инструмент для предварительного планирования: он пригодится контент-мейкерам, видеографам, стримерам и монтажёрам, которым нужно заранее понять, сколько места на диске или интернет-канала займёт ролик ещё до экспорта или загрузки.
Какие данные нужно ввести
- Разрешение видео — выберите 1920×1080 (1080p), 1280×720 (720p) или 3840×2160 (4K). Калькулятор разбивает значение на ширину и высоту, чтобы посчитать количество пикселей в каждом кадре.
- Частота кадров (fps) — сколько кадров показывается в секунду (например, 24, 30 или 60).
- Длительность видео (минуты) — продолжительность ролика, по которой рассчитывается общий размер файла.
- Степень сжатия — насколько агрессивно сжимается видео. Чем выше число, тем сильнее сжатие, ниже битрейт и меньше размер файла.
Как работает формула
Битрейт вычисляется так:
$$\text{Битрейт (бит/с)} = \frac{\text{Ширина} \times \text{Высота} \times 24 \times \text{Частота кадров}}{\text{Степень сжатия}}$$Число 24 — это предполагаемая глубина цвета (24 бита, то есть по 8 бит на каждый канал — красный, зелёный и синий). Ширина × Высота даёт количество пикселей в кадре, умножение на 24 — число бит на кадр, а умножение на частоту кадров — «сырой» битрейт в битах в секунду. Деление на степень сжатия показывает, насколько кодек уменьшает этот исходный объём данных.
Размер файла рассчитывается дальше: биты в секунду × 60 × длительность в минутах дают общее число бит, которое затем делится на 8 × 1024 × 1024 для перевода в мегабайты (и ещё на 1024 — для гигабайт).
Разбор на примере
Предположим, у вас ролик 1080p с частотой 30 fps, длительностью 10 минут и степенью сжатия 100.
- Пикселей в кадре: \(1920 \times 1080 = 2\,073\,600\)
- Бит в секунду: \(\dfrac{2\,073\,600 \times 24 \times 30}{100} = 14\,929\,920\ \text{бит/с} \approx 14\,930\ \text{Кбит/с} \approx 14{,}93\ \text{Мбит/с}\)
- Всего бит за 10 минут: \(14\,929\,920 \times 60 \times 10 = 8\,957\,952\,000\ \text{бит}\)
- Размер файла: \(\dfrac{8\,957\,952\,000}{8 \times 1024 \times 1024} \approx 1\,067\ \text{МБ} \approx 1{,}04\ \text{ГБ}\)
Часто задаваемые вопросы
Какую степень сжатия выбрать? Всё зависит от вашего кодека и желаемого качества. Низкие значения (например, 20–50) сохраняют больше деталей, но дают крупные файлы, а высокие (100 и больше) экономят место за счёт качества. Попробуйте несколько вариантов и найдите оптимальный баланс.
Почему калькулятор берёт глубину цвета 24 бита? 24 бита (по 8 бит на каждый RGB-канал) — стандарт для большинства потребительского видео. Если вы работаете с 10-битным HDR-материалом, реальный битрейт будет выше этой оценки.
Это точный размер файла? Нет — это оценка. Реальные кодеки используют переменный битрейт, к видео добавляются звуковые дорожки и служебные данные контейнера, поэтому относитесь к результату как к удобному ориентиру для планирования, а не как к точной цифре.